Output 3b12f593261729f215d26fb823426fab103a3e1e0891907d69ea9042bc4a57f0:0

value
1007259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daef08dd361ae11737a2dade49dff4176b799742 OP_EQUAL
address
3MedanBFF3dnpFgGrUd6TagNGDxzEiZYnr
transaction
3b12f593261729f215d26fb823426fab103a3e1e0891907d69ea9042bc4a57f0
confirmations
267434
spent
true